Geometry question for homework.
mars1129 [50]

So remember that the distance formula is \sqrt{(x_2-x_1)^2+(y_2-y_1)^2} .

1.

\sqrt{(4-4)^2+(-2-(-5))^2}\\ \sqrt{0^2+3^2}\\ \sqrt{0+9}\\ \sqrt{9}\\ 3

Distance between (4,-5) and (4,-2) is 3 units.

2.

\sqrt{(1-(-1))^2+(1-4)^2}\\ \sqrt{2^2+(-3)^2}\\ \sqrt{4+9}\\ \sqrt{13}

Distance between (1,1) and (-1,4) is √13 (or 3.61 rounded to the hundreths) units.
